logo

Output 3bcbc83d14a590affeef395c32329e4550ad5ff8a6fbbfe879a1e2466845ef70:0

value
76000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55513d75dc7be47673c5026bced1b4049e965f69 OP_EQUAL
address
39U8gWUe1HYKPBELWBxiD5CA4pxZzsTnFc
transaction
3bcbc83d14a590affeef395c32329e4550ad5ff8a6fbbfe879a1e2466845ef70